Project Overview

MFS Engineers & Surveyors (MFS) provided professional site/civil engineering services in support of the Chocolate Factory Theater Project located in the borough of Queens, New York. The project consisted of an adaptive reuse of the existing one-story industrial building on site. The existing structure has a gross footprint of approximately 7,500 square feet (SF).

Project Details

The MFS team supported the project by providing professional site/civil engineering services to assist with the development of the NYCDOB Builders Pavement Plans (BPP) for right-of-way improvements, storm water and sanitary sewer upgrades including stormwater management via NYCDEP Site Connection Proposal (SCP), and NYCDPR Street Tree Planting Plans.

Preparation of the Builders Pavement Plans (BPP) utilized NYC DOB/DOT standards and specifications, including bringing existing pedestrian ramps up to current code. NYCDPR permitting was triggered by proposed construction within 50’ of the two (2) existing fronting NYCDPR street trees; submitted plans documented proposed tree protection during construction via NYCDPR standards and specifications. Sewer modifications included new connections and stormwater management designed to address existing stormwater drainage within the context of current code requirements.

Initial plans were prepared for fundraising purposes; once funding is secured, MFS will formally submit permitting documents and pursue necessary approvals for this cultural reimagination of The Chocolate Factory Theater.
